Important differences between broccoli and grapefruit

  • Broccoli has more vitamin K, vitamin C, folate, vitamin B6, manganese, iron, phosphorus, vitamin B2, and vitamin B5; however, grapefruit is richer in vitamin A.
  • Broccoli's daily need coverage for vitamin K is 85% more.
  • Broccoli contains 10 times more manganese than grapefruit. Broccoli contains 0.21mg of manganese, while grapefruit contains 0.022mg.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Broccoli, raw and Grapefruit, raw, pink and red, all areas.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Broccoli Grapefruit DV% diff.
Vitamin K 101.6µg 0µg 85%
Vitamin C 89.2mg 31.2mg 64%
Folate 63µg 13µg 13%
Vitamin B6 0.175mg 0.053mg 9%
Manganese 0.21mg 0.022mg 8%
Iron 0.73mg 0.08mg 8%
Vitamin B2 0.117mg 0.031mg 7%
Phosphorus 66mg 18mg 7%
Vitamin B5 0.573mg 0.262mg 6%
Potassium 316mg 135mg 5%
Protein 2.82g 0.77g 4%
Selenium 2.5µg 0.1µg 4%
Vitamin E 0.78mg 0.13mg 4%
Fiber 2.6g 1.6g 4%
Zinc 0.41mg 0.07mg 3%
Vitamin A 31µg 58µg 3%
Vitamin B3 0.639mg 0.204mg 3%
Calcium 47mg 22mg 3%
Magnesium 21mg 9mg 3%
Copper 0.049mg 0.032mg 2%
Choline 18.7mg 7.7mg 2%
Vitamin B1 0.071mg 0.043mg 2%
Fructose 0.68g 1.77g 1%
Sodium 33mg 0mg 1%
Carbs 6.64g 10.66g 1%
Calories 34kcal 42kcal 0%
Fats 0.37g 0.14g 0%
Net carbs 4.04g 9.06g N/A
Sugar 1.7g 6.89g N/A
Saturated fat 0.039g 0.021g 0%
Monounsaturated fat 0.011g 0.02g 0%
Polyunsaturated fat 0.038g 0.036g 0%
